Organized by the Batabano Committee this year's Carnival Friday show featured local band Cay NRG, Soca Queen Alison Hinds, Andy Armstrong and Oscar B and his band. Cay NRG handled themselves well and gave a polished performance while featuring Pirates Week Festival Song Winner Vashti Bodden. The event also featured skillful moko jumbies and various carnival characters. Never before have I seen moko jumbies jump over two women standing tall. My heart was in my mouth for a fraction of a second - but they did it! Well done!

The crowd at first was a bit sparse but by the time the Queen arrived on stage the place had filled up in a big way.  And she did not disappoint.
